The History and Origin of Mediterranean Cuisine

The Mediterranean cuisine is renowned for its rich history and diverse flavors. It encompasses the culinary traditions of countries bordering the Mediterranean Sea, including Greece, Italy, Spain, and Morocco. This region has a long-standing history of trade and cultural exchange, which has heavily influenced its cuisine.

The Mediterranean diet dates back thousands of years, with its roots in ancient civilizations such as the Greeks and Romans. These civilizations relied on simple, wholesome ingredients that were abundant in the region, such as olive oil, fish, vegetables, and whole grains. The use of herbs and spices, such as oregano, thyme, and garlic, added depth and complexity to their dishes.

Mediterranean cuisine is characterized by its emphasis on fresh, seasonal ingredients and a balanced approach to eating. It is known for its use of heart-healthy fats, like olive oil, and a high consumption of fruits, vegetables, legumes, and whole grains. This combination of ingredients provides a wide array of nutrients, making it a popular choice for those seeking a healthy lifestyle.

Today, Mediterranean cuisine has gained global popularity due to its delicious flavors and numerous health benefits. It is recognized as one of the healthiest dietary patterns in the world, with studies linking it to a reduced risk of heart disease, cancer, and other chronic conditions.

Grilling: Unlocking Halibut’s Natural Char

Grilling halibut is a popular choice for many seafood lovers, as it allows you to achieve a delicious smoky flavor while maintaining the fish’s natural moisture. To grill halibut Mediterranean style, start by marinating the fillets in a combination of olive oil, lemon juice, garlic, and Mediterranean herbs such as oregano and thyme. This will infuse the fish with a burst of flavor. Preheat the grill to medium-high heat and place the halibut fillets directly on the grates. Cook for about 4-6 minutes per side, or until the fish is opaque and flakes easily with a fork. This method is perfect for those who enjoy a slightly charred and crispy exterior with a tender and juicy interior.

Baking and Roasting: Sealing in Moisture and Flavors

If you prefer a more hands-off approach to cooking halibut Mediterranean style, baking and roasting is an excellent choice. This method allows you to seal in the fish’s moisture and flavors, resulting in a tender and succulent dish. To bake or roast halibut, pre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Place the seasoned halibut fillets on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per or aluminum foil. Drizzle with olive oil and season with salt, pepper, and your choice of Mediterranean spices. Bake for approximately 12-15 minutes, or until the fish is opaque and flakes easily. The gentle heat of the oven will ensure a perfectly cooked halibut with a moist and flavorful outcome.

Steaming and Poaching: Tenderizing through Gentle Cooking

If you prefer a cooking method that preserves the delicate texture of halibut while infusing it with Mediterranean flavors, steaming and poaching is an ideal choice. These gentle cooking techniques ensure that the fish remains moist and tender, resulting in a melt-in-your-mouth experience. To steam halibut, fill a pot with a couple of inches of water and bring it to a simmer. Place the seasoned halibut fillets in a steamer basket or on a heatproof plate and carefully lower it into the pot. Cover and steam for approximately 8-10 minutes, or until the fish is opaque and flakes easily. To poach halibut, fill a shallow pan with a flavorful liquid such as vegetable broth, white wine, or a combination of lemon juice and water. Bring the liquid to a simmer and gently add the seasoned halibut fillets. Poach for about 10 minutes, or until the fish is opaque and flakes easily. Both methods result in a delicate and tender halibut that is infused with the flavors of the Mediterranean.

Wine Pairings: Elevating the Dining Experience

No Mediterranean-inspired meal would be complete without the perfect wine pairing. Choosing the right wine can enhance the flavors of both the halibut and the accompanying dishes, taking your dining experience to the next level. For the halibut Mediterranean style dish, opt for a light and crisp white wine such as a Sauvignon Blanc or a Pinot Grigio. These wines provide a refreshing counterpoint to the rich flavors of the fish while complementing the fresh and vibrant flavors of the salads. If you prefer red wine, a light-bodied red such as a Gamay or a Beaujolais can also work well. Remember to serve the wine chilled to ensure optimal enjoyment.

Halibut Mediterranean Style

Discover a delicious and healthy way to prepare halibut with Mediterranean-inspired flavors. This recipe combines fresh halibut fillets with aromatic ingredients like garlic, tomatoes, olives, and herbs.

  • 4 fresh halibut fillets
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 cloves of garlic (minced)
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es
  • 1/4 cup Kalamata olives (pitted and halved)
  • 1 tablespoon capers
  • 2 tablespoons fresh herbs (such as basil, parsley, or oregano, chopped)
  • Zest of 1 lemon
  • Salt and pepper (to taste)
  1. Season the halibut fillets with salt and pepper.
  2. Heat olive oil in a pan over medium-high heat. Sear the halibut fillets for 3-4 minutes per side, or until golden brown. Remove the fillets from the pan and set aside.
  3. In the same pan, add garlic and sauté for 1 minute. Add cherry tomatoes, Kalamata olives, and capers. Cook for 2-3 minutes, or until the tomatoes are softened.
  4. Return the halibut fillets to the pan. Cook for an additional 2-3 minutes, or until the fish is cooked through.
  5. Sprinkle the fish with fresh herbs and lemon zest. Serve the halibut Mediterranean style immediately.
